What you'll learn

Where Scenes of Everyday Life: Mastering Genre Painting takes you

Move beyond formal portraits and explore the beauty of the mundane. Learn how artists captured the hidden stories of kitchens, taverns, and street corners to change how we see the world.

  1. 1

    The Shift from Gods to Commoners

    • Why Ordinary People Became Worthy Subjects
    • The Rise of the Middle-Class Art Buyer
    • Moving Away from Religious and Royal Commissions
    • How Small Paintings Changed Home Decor
  2. 2

    The Golden Age of Domestic Scenes

    • The Quiet Beauty of Household Chores
    • Mastering the Glow of Window Light
    • Hidden Symbols in Kitchen Still Lifes
    • The Art of Painting Textures: Silk, Bread, and Stone
    • Privacy and Peeking into Private Rooms
  3. 3

    Rowdy Taverns and Public Life

    • Capturing Chaos: The Energy of Crowded Inns
    • Moral Lessons Hidden in Drunken Scenes
    • The Comedy of Human Errors and Expressions
  4. 4

    Storytelling Without Words

    • Using Body Language to Suggest a Secret
    • The Power of the Unopened Letter
    • Eye Contact and the Viewer's Role
    • Setting the Stage with Background Details
    • The Use of Mirrors to Expand the Story
  5. 5

    Social Commentary and Class

    • Contrasting the Wealthy and the Working Class
    • Satire: Poking Fun at High Society
    • The Dignity of Labor in Rural Painting
    • Fashion as a Marker of Status and Character
  6. 6

    Light, Shadow, and Atmosphere

    • Creating Depth in Small Interior Spaces
    • The Warmth of Candlelight and Fireplaces
    • Outdoor Markets and Shifting Natural Light
  7. 7

    The Evolution into Modern Life

    • From Village Squares to City Cafes
    • Capturing the Speed of the Industrial Age
    • The Loneliness of the Modern City Dweller
    • How Photography Influenced Painted Moments
    • The Legacy of the Everyday in Contemporary Art
